What is compliance risk management?

Compliance Risk Management refers to the process of identifying, assessing, and mitigating risks that arise from failing to comply with laws, regulations, and internal policies. Professionals in this field ensure that organizations operate within the legal frameworks and ethical standards relevant to their industry. They develop policies, conduct audits, and provide training to reduce the risk of violations, which can lead to legal penalties, financial losses, or reputational damage. Effective compliance risk management helps organizations maintain trust with stakeholders and avoid costly regulatory issues.

How does a compliance risk management professional typically collaborate with other departments within an organization?

Compliance Risk Management professionals work closely with departments such as Legal, Internal Audit, Operations, and IT to ensure company policies and procedures meet regulatory requirements. They often coordinate cross-functional meetings to assess risks, develop mitigation strategies, and implement compliance training. This collaborative approach helps identify potential compliance gaps early and ensures the organization maintains a culture of ethical conduct and regulatory adherence. Effective communication and partnership with various teams are essential to proactively manage risks and respond to regulatory changes.

What is the difference between Compliance Risk Management vs Compliance Analyst?

AspectCompliance Risk ManagementCompliance Analyst
CertificationsCertified Compliance & Ethics Professional (CCEP), Certified Risk Management Professional (CRMP)Certified Compliance & Ethics Professional (CCEP), Certified Regulatory Compliance Manager (CRCM)
Work EnvironmentFocuses on risk assessment, policy development, and strategic compliance planningConducts audits, monitors compliance, and reports findings
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in financial, healthcare, and corporate sectors for risk oversightCommon in financial services, healthcare, and regulatory agencies for day-to-day compliance tasks

Compliance Risk Management involves strategic oversight of compliance risks and policy development, while Compliance Analysts focus on executing compliance audits and monitoring. Both roles are essential but differ in scope and responsibilities within organizations.
